Mashemeji Derby Rescheduled for Sunday December 7th

By Sports EditorNovember 26, 2025No Comments2 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

Fans of Gor Mahia and AFC Leopards can breathe a sigh of relief following the announcement of a new date for the highly anticipated Mashemeji Derby. The match, initially scheduled for Sunday, November 27, faced postponement due to venue complications but is now confirmed to take place on Sunday, December 7, at the Nyayo National Stadium.

The derby, which is regarded as Kenya’s most significant club football clash, was originally slated to be held at Nyayo Stadium. However, Gor Mahia ran into difficulties securing a suitable venue when it was learned that the stadium had been booked for a state event by the government, while Kasarani Stadium was already allocated for Nairobi United’s CAF Champions League match against DR Congo’s Maniema FC on the same day.

Nairobi United’s organizers had reserved Kasarani for two days to allow for training arrangements, emphasizing the importance of proper preparation for international fixtures. With Nyayo Stadium unavailable and complications surrounding potential venue shifts for November 29 proving unfeasible, Gor Mahia was left with no option but to inform the Football Kenya Federation (FKF) about their inability to host the derby as planned.

Gor Mahia’s recent form had seen them secure six victories in eight matches, positioning them favorably as they approached the derby. However, their momentum faced a setback with a surprising 4-1 defeat to APS Bomet in their last outing. Meanwhile, AFC Leopards have struggled, finding themselves in a troubling three-match winless streak, which has raised concerns among their supporters.

The impending clash promises to be a thrilling encounter, as both teams will be eager to reclaim momentum and secure bragging rights in this storied rivalry. With the derby now set for December 7, FKF will work diligently to realign the league fixtures to accommodate the changes, ensuring a seamless schedule leading up to one of the most important matches in Kenyan football.
